当前市场上大量的液压挖掘机存在机械零件使用寿命低和优化不科学等问题,严重影响液压挖掘机的性能。为了延长液压挖掘机的使用寿命,确保液压挖掘机能够可靠、稳定和安全地运行,优化其动臂结构十分重要。因此,在分析动臂结构开裂问题的基础上,分析动臂结构的受力情况,并提出相应的改进方案,以期为相关设计人员提供借鉴和参考。
At present,a large number of hydraulic excavators have the problems of low service life of mechanical parts and unscientific optimization model,which seriously affect the operation performance of hydraulic excavators.In this context,in order to prolong the service life of hydraulic excavators and ensure the reliable,stable and safe operation of hydraulic excavators,it is particularly important to strengthen the structural design and optimization of the boom Important.Based on the analysis of the boom structure cracking problem,this paper analyzes the force situation of the boom structure,and studies the improved design of the boom structure.It is hoped that this study can provide effective reference for designers.
